Occupational Therapist (OT) at Interim HealthCare summary:
An Occupational Therapist (OT) assesses and treats individuals with physical, sensory, or cognitive issues that affect their ability to perform daily activities. They develop customized treatment plans aimed at improving clients' functional abilities and promote independence in their daily lives. OTs collaborate with healthcare teams and provide education to patients and families regarding adaptive techniques and equipment.
